Former Japan PM Shinzo Abe apologises while correcting statement on political funding scandal

Former Japanese Prime Minister Shinzo Abe apologised to the citizens of the country for making incorrect statements in the parliament in connection with a political funding scandal. "Even though the accounting procedures happened without my knowledge, I feel morally responsible for what happened," the former PM told a parliamentary committee. Abe pledged to work to regain public trust while apologising from his heart.
